diff options
author | Greg Bedwell <greg_bedwell@sn.scee.net> | 2016-11-02 23:17:05 +0000 |
---|---|---|
committer | Greg Bedwell <greg_bedwell@sn.scee.net> | 2016-11-02 23:17:05 +0000 |
commit | 5fc6f9459190fa1c9cb5e117c74aee45c80703ed (patch) | |
tree | 773f9261f1a3efd8d84d13dffee94e3aca8e16cd /llvm/lib/Object/Error.cpp | |
parent | 1f368434f0dd2af95f38b375c58c9b9fa7d9235f (diff) | |
download | llvm-5fc6f9459190fa1c9cb5e117c74aee45c80703ed.zip llvm-5fc6f9459190fa1c9cb5e117c74aee45c80703ed.tar.gz llvm-5fc6f9459190fa1c9cb5e117c74aee45c80703ed.tar.bz2 |
Revert "[InstCombine] allow splat vector folds in adjustMinMax()"
This reverts commit r285732.
This change introduced a new assertion failure in the following
testcase at -O2:
typedef short __v8hi __attribute__((__vector_size__(16)));
__v8hi foo(__v8hi &V1, __v8hi &V2, unsigned mask) {
__v8hi Result = V1;
if (mask & 0x80)
Result[0] = V2[0];
return Result;
}
llvm-svn: 285866
Diffstat (limited to 'llvm/lib/Object/Error.cpp')
0 files changed, 0 insertions, 0 deletions